Browse over to Wikipedia and read up on Anheuser Busch – the Budweiser company. There was a change of ownership recently and they have made some budget cuts that would explain the lameness of their ads. I pulled this from Wiki:
“Since the acquisition by InBev, significant changes in advertising plans have been rolled out, predicated on the belief that “changing demographics and media habits no longer require spending as much on mainstream sports events”
- A-B is cutting its television advertising budget for the U.S. broadcast of the 2010 Winter Olympics and the 2012 Summer Olympics and “won’t seek to be the exclusive beer advertiser” for those events
-dropping Omnicom Group’s Goodby, Silverstein & Partners, and other advertising agencies “responsible for some of its best-known past ads”
- paying by the project rather than an annual lump sum
- reducing the annual number of new advertisements from 100 to 50-60.
